BROADCAST ANNOUNCEMENTS
Sir, —In reply to “Accuracy’s” letter regarding the broadcasting of news items from 2YA, I would like to say a few words in defence of the announcer. Considering that your correspondent has gone back over a period of nearly six months for his complaints, and has found only five, I think he should pride himself in having an excellent service, especially when one considers the number of hours 2YA is on the-air. I am sure listeners-in are thankful that “Accuracy” is not the announcer, when they notice that he made one mistake in his short letter —he accuses the announcer of reversing the result of a Test football match in South Africa, whereas the mistake was made in the first Transvaal match, when a win for New Zealand 9—45 was announced, instead of a win for their opponents by 6 —o.—I am, etc., REASONABLE. Wellington. November 22.
